Sun, Sea, Sand and Safe Sex

With increasing numbers of people travelling to far and ever more exotic holiday destinations Over The Rainbow will consider some of the implications of travel for your sexual health.

An incredible one in five gay men in the UK catches a sexually transmitted infection while away on holiday.

Suggestions from Over The Rainbow to protect yourself whilst on holiday and to help you enjoy that holiday fling, without bringing home any unexpected holiday souvenirs.

Condoms

Make sure you take a supply. In some countries they may be out of date and not kite marked. You can get free condoms and lube from Over The Rainbow.

Lube

Be careful which lube you use as all oil based lube will corrode the condom. Don’t use sun oil and be careful when putting on the condom if you have sun oil/cream on your hands this will also harm the condom.

Booze

Don’t get dehydrated drink plenty of water before you go out boozing and it’s a good idea to drink more water before you go to sleep this will help with the hangover in the morning.

Local Culture

The foreign office and commonwealth office advises you to find out about local culture, customs and laws of the countries you may be visiting.

Some countries find it offensive to see open displays of affection between 2 people of the same sex.

In some countries it is customary to walk down the street hand in hand with another man/woman. However, this may be acceptable to the locals from that area/place but be offensive if you were to display openness like this.

Beware that some police forces in the world have been known to entrap men by hanging around gay cruising areas in certain countries.

Be wary of people who may want to befriend you they may have a hidden agenda and want to rob or harm you in some way.

Don’t accept packages from people you have just met or befriended. Whether they are from the country you are visiting or someone else on holiday at the same place as you.

Make sure you get travel insurance as well as sexual health insurance i.e.; take condoms with you!
